What is IIoT and Why Should You Care?
IIoT, or the Industrial Internet of Things, is basically connecting all sorts of devices, sensors, and machines to the internet to collect and exchange data. Think of it as giving everything a digital voice so it can share what's happening in real-time. In sports management, this means everything from tracking player performance to managing stadium operations can be done smarter and more efficiently.
The Growing Importance of IIoT in Sports
IIoT is revolutionizing sports, offering a blend of real-time data analytics, enhanced fan experiences, and optimized operational efficiencies. This transformation is not just about adopting new technologies; it's about reshaping the entire sports ecosystem. From grassroots sports to professional leagues, IIoT is proving to be an indispensable tool. Real-time data collection is one of the most significant impacts, offering insights into athlete performance, fan behavior, and facility usage. Wearable sensors, for example, track an athlete’s vital signs, movement, and biomechanics, providing coaches and trainers with critical information to enhance training regimens and prevent injuries. Stadiums equipped with IoT devices monitor crowd flow, environmental conditions, and energy consumption, ensuring a safe, comfortable, and sustainable environment for fans. This data-driven approach enables better decision-making across the board, from player management to resource allocation. Moreover, IIoT enhances the fan experience by offering personalized content, interactive games, and seamless navigation within venues. Mobile apps integrated with stadium sensors provide real-time updates on wait times, seat availability, and concession options, improving overall satisfaction. The ability to collect and analyze vast amounts of data also opens up new revenue streams through targeted advertising, personalized merchandise, and premium services. As the adoption of IIoT continues to grow, sports organizations are finding innovative ways to leverage these technologies to gain a competitive edge, improve operational efficiency, and create more engaging experiences for fans and athletes alike. This shift towards data-driven decision-making is set to define the future of sports management, making it imperative for professionals in the field to embrace and understand these technological advancements.

Diving Deeper: Specific Examples
To really nail down the impact, let's look at some specific examples.
Imagine a basketball team using wearable sensors to track players' heart rates, acceleration, and jump heights during practice. Coaches can use this data to fine-tune training regimens, prevent injuries, and optimize player performance. This level of granular data analysis was simply not possible before IIoT. Furthermore, consider a stadium equipped with smart sensors that monitor everything from temperature and humidity to crowd density and air quality. These sensors can automatically adjust HVAC systems, lighting, and security protocols to ensure a safe and comfortable environment for fans. During peak events, predictive analytics can help manage crowd flow, minimizing bottlenecks and enhancing the overall experience. The benefits are clear: safer venues, happier fans, and optimized resource utilization. Moreover, IIoT is transforming the way fans engage with sports beyond the stadium. Mobile apps provide real-time updates, personalized content, and interactive games, creating a more immersive and engaging experience. Social media integration allows fans to share their experiences, connect with other fans, and participate in online communities. These digital touchpoints extend the reach of sports organizations, fostering stronger relationships with fans and creating new revenue streams. IIoT also enables new forms of sports broadcasting, such as augmented reality overlays, interactive replays, and personalized viewing experiences. Fans can access real-time statistics, player profiles, and behind-the-scenes content, enhancing their understanding and appreciation of the game. As IIoT continues to evolve, we can expect even more innovative applications that transform the way sports are played, managed, and experienced.

Breaking Down the Roles: What Do They Really Do?
Let's dig a little deeper into what these roles entail.
Data Scientist/Analyst: Think of these guys as the detectives of the sports world. They sift through mountains of data generated by wearable sensors, stadium cameras, and ticketing systems to uncover valuable insights. Their analyses help coaches make better decisions about training regimens, help marketers tailor content to specific fan segments, and help stadium operators optimize resource allocation. To succeed in this role, you'll need strong analytical skills, proficiency in statistical software, and a deep understanding of sports dynamics. Moreover, data scientists in sports are increasingly using machine learning and artificial intelligence to predict outcomes, identify patterns, and automate decision-making. They might develop algorithms to predict player injuries, forecast ticket sales, or optimize pricing strategies. The ability to communicate complex findings in a clear and concise manner is also crucial, as data scientists need to work closely with coaches, managers, and other stakeholders. This role is not just about crunching numbers; it's about telling a story with data and driving meaningful change within the organization.
IoT Solutions Architect: These are the master builders of the IIoT world. They design and implement the infrastructure that connects all the different devices and systems within a sports organization. They ensure that data flows seamlessly between sensors, servers, and user interfaces, and that the entire system is secure and scalable. Their expertise is essential for creating a connected ecosystem that supports real-time data analysis, automation, and enhanced fan experiences. A strong background in computer science, electrical engineering, and networking is essential for this role. Furthermore, IoT solutions architects need to stay up-to-date with the latest technological advancements and industry trends. They work closely with vendors, developers, and IT teams to ensure that the IIoT infrastructure meets the specific needs of the sports organization. Their responsibilities might include selecting appropriate hardware and software, designing network architectures, implementing security protocols, and optimizing system performance. This role is critical for ensuring that the IIoT investments deliver maximum value and contribute to the overall success of the organization.
Sports Technology Manager: These managers are the conductors of the IIoT orchestra. They oversee the implementation and maintenance of all the IIoT technologies within a sports organization. They work closely with data scientists, IoT solutions architects, and other stakeholders to ensure that the technologies align with the organization's strategic goals. Their responsibilities might include budgeting, vendor management, project planning, and training. A strong understanding of both technology and sports management is essential for this role. Moreover, sports technology managers need to be able to communicate effectively with both technical and non-technical audiences. They need to be able to explain complex concepts in a clear and concise manner and to advocate for the adoption of new technologies. Their role is to bridge the gap between technology and business, ensuring that the organization leverages IIoT to its fullest potential. They also need to stay abreast of the latest industry trends and best practices, and to identify opportunities for innovation. This role is critical for driving the adoption of IIoT and for ensuring that the organization remains competitive in the rapidly evolving sports landscape.

Building Your Skill Set
Let's break down how you can actually acquire these skills. If you're looking to break into this field, here's some advice.
Education: Consider pursuing a degree in data science, computer science, or a related field. Many universities also offer specialized programs in sports management with a focus on technology. These programs provide a solid foundation in data analytics, IoT technologies, and business principles. In addition to formal education, look for opportunities to gain hands-on experience through internships, projects, and volunteer work. Participating in hackathons, coding competitions, and data science challenges can also help you develop your skills and build your portfolio. Moreover, online courses and certifications can be a great way to supplement your education and stay up-to-date with the latest trends. Platforms like Coursera, Udemy, and edX offer a wide range of courses in data science, IoT, and sports management. Earning certifications in areas like data analysis, cloud computing, and cybersecurity can also enhance your credibility and demonstrate your commitment to professional development.
Networking: Attend industry events, conferences, and workshops to connect with professionals in the field. Networking is a great way to learn about new opportunities, get advice from experienced professionals, and build relationships that can help you advance your career. Join professional organizations, such as the Sports Analytics Society and the International Association of Venue Managers, to connect with like-minded individuals and stay informed about industry trends. Moreover, online communities and forums can be a valuable resource for networking and knowledge sharing. Platforms like LinkedIn and Reddit host numerous groups and discussions related to sports technology and IIoT. Participating in these online communities can help you build your network, ask questions, and share your own insights.
Projects: Work on personal projects that showcase your skills and demonstrate your passion for sports and technology. Building a data dashboard that visualizes player performance metrics or developing a mobile app that enhances the fan experience can be a great way to stand out from the crowd. Use open-source data sets and tools to analyze sports data and create innovative solutions. Furthermore, collaborate with other students or professionals on projects to gain experience working in a team and to learn from others. Participating in group projects can also help you develop your communication and leadership skills. Be sure to document your projects and to share your work online through platforms like GitHub and LinkedIn. This will allow potential employers to see your skills and to assess your potential.
